Via Verde is accused of defrauding several consumers with an alleged scheme using IDs, news diary this Tuesday. Customers denounce the company for “fraud”, “pressure”, “scheme” and “loyalty tricks”.
In November, consumers submitted dozens of complaints to the complaints portal, up 50% from the previous month, and allege that the company is sending a message to customers informing them about member ID failure registration, asking them to replace it. Even if the devices are working properly, replacement requests are sent via email.
According to what the victims reported DN, the company “acts in bad faith” and deceives customers. According to them, this is “a strategy for the client to stick to a new method of paying monthly or annually for equipment.”
In response to allegations made by consumers on Portal da Queixa, the company reports cm which “strongly denies any allegations of fraud that is inconsistent with the brand’s values and practices,” the statement said.
The company also adds that “it always strives to guarantee the best service for its customers” and explains that “whenever a customer goes through tolls and a transaction fails, Via Verde will contact the customer directly to resolve the issue.”
Regarding issues with IDs, “Via Verde only contacts the customer when a yellow light comes on at the toll crossing, indicating a potential problem,” he says.
“If the issue is confirmed, the customer can sign up for a Via Verde plan or, if they so choose, buy a new ID. The final decision always remains with the client,” they guarantee.
